Transaction 51467ce99570567910ef4fcb001f1e74e1cd966c102fc432fcda17f07430d0fa

1 Input
2 Outputs
  • 51467ce99570567910ef4fcb001f1e74e1cd966c102fc432fcda17f07430d0fa:0
  • value  765625
    address  1PwRi37pAQBED2zFgvZkXB6mn7appS8pvd
  • 51467ce99570567910ef4fcb001f1e74e1cd966c102fc432fcda17f07430d0fa:1
  • value  110535191
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C